Output 50ff22f16bad8343e5a9fdbf95ccba0c306d2cab268fc4ffd7f3f7a858a6608a:2

value
2382076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73d3b424e748d4ed66ef2eb36cfdf46c153df762 OP_EQUAL
address
3CFTF2wtdycQgrqdsVMV8HoYMv2e7YeUwD
transaction
50ff22f16bad8343e5a9fdbf95ccba0c306d2cab268fc4ffd7f3f7a858a6608a
spent
true